Craving breakfast foods or simply want a quiet cozy place to hang out while enjoying your coffee? Then Zia Gianna, the new Italian café in Dorchester, is worthy of your attention. With the warm-colored interior, scenery photos of the Mediterranean island up on the walls, and kind greetings from the owner Nino Barbalace, one will sure feel as if they have arrived in Sicily as they enter the café. 

Nino's signature Brioche sandwiches were inspired by American-style biscuit breakfast sandwiches. Traditionally, a brioche is eaten with whipped cream or jam as Italian breakfast is mainly sweet. In an attempt to satisfy the American taste buds Nino decided to add pancetta (Italian bacon), ham, sausage, cheese and much more to the already flavorful brioche. >> Read More

MAHA invites you to the 3rd Annual Taste of Dorchester, Apr. 28

Join the Massachusetts Affordable Housing Alliance on Thursday, April 28 for a taste you won't forget! The 3rd Annual Taste of Dorchester will take place from 6:00 to 8:30 p.m. at the Dorchester's IBEW Hall (256 Freeport Street). Our local restaurant community has quickly made this event a Dorchester tradition! Come enjoy delicious culinary dishes from a variety of restaurants across Dorchester – from Jamaican to Vietnamese, Cape Verdean, Irish, Indian, Soul Food and American. You will also be invited to sample local ice cream and fair trade coffee. Tickets are $35 in advance, $40 at the door, and $20 for seniors & children. You can find out more here. >> Read More

Savin Bar and Kitchen Opens

Giving new life to a space long-occupied by restaurants, Savin Bar and Kitchen opens the week of March 14 at 112 Savin Hill Ave - just steps from the Savin Hill T Stop. Beverages, sandwiches, snacks, brunch, dinner, a bar open daily to 1 a.m. and a proximity to the delectable Savin Scoop make this a bite not to be missed! Check out Savin Bar and Kitchen in the Boston Globe, on Facebook, at the fledgling SavinBarAndKitchen.com (menu found here) or better yet, stop by!

The Dot2Dot Café is a locally-owned and operated cafe in the heart of Dorchester, in Boston, Massachusetts. We specialize in brunch, pastries and dinner. We opened in 2008.

Here's 5 reasons to make Dot2Dot a regular stop:

1) Food You Already Love- try our "fabulous, genuinely memorable" brioche French toast with eggs and bacon. Don't forget we do catering, too, and we're very reasonably priced...

2) Food You Can't Wait to Try. For example, check out our "extraordinary" D2D Fish Breakfast: a "gently sautéed cod fillet with a perfect, vibrant romesco, plus excellent creamy grits and two eggs". Try our famous quiches, oatmeal flapjacks and ginger scones

3) Dinners You Won't Find Anywhere Else. Our menu changes every week! How about: hot-and-sour papaya salad; an eggplant stir-fry with chilies and shallots, plus rice and fried plantains; followed by pineapple sorbet served in brandy-snap baskets? We always have vegan options.

4) Great Service & Atmosphere- "I have lived in Dorchester for 48 years and never have I found a restaurant so welcoming and friendly as the Dot2Dot Cafe". The space is "bright, modern and well laid out". We're kid-friendly - we even have children's books and a sofa to read them on!

5) Community Hang Out - we showcase local artists, often have jazz or singer-songwriters at the weekends, and host open mic nights once a month. And we have free WiFi. Dorchester is multicultural, and so are we!

"If we can we will!" All of our food is cooked to order. We are open to your suggestions and will make every effort to prepare your food the way you like it. If you don't see it on the menu just ask your server. Our Story: McKenna's Café has been Dorchester's neighborhood café serving breakfast and lunch for the past decade since 1999. McKenna's café is well known for its scrumptious breakfast starting as early as 5:30AM and served seven days a week. At McKenna's Café, breakfast is served All Day. Our food includes a unique assortment of omelets, egg creations, pancakes, French Toast, smoked salmon, and delectable coffees all served in the McKenna's tradition of gigantic portions and friendly service. We also have the best neighborhood lunch in town including deli sandwiches, such as pastrami and corned beef, huge salads topped with turkey tips, burgers, wraps and hearty meals including steak tips and chicken parm. We make most of our food fresh on premises including our own made potato salad, chicken salad with cranberries, chicken and rice soup and beef stew. We have many regulars that love our fresh "Fish Friday" served fried or baked with coleslaw and lemon wedges.
